<blockquote data-quote="Laelkhunter" data-source="post: 2068843" data-attributes="member: 38154"><p>From what I remember from years ago, the Small Base resizing die was recommended when you are reloading for Browning BAR rifles, and lever action rifles. I am not sure why, because the regular sizing die is supposed to resize the fired case back to factory unfired dimensions, which should chamber in most rifles anyway. If you can't get a new cartridge to chamber in your gun, you have more problems than needing a small base die. That's in most cases anyway, YMMV</p></blockquote><p></p>
